How To Overcome Lower Throat Pain?

Yesterday, out of blue, I started to get lower throat pain, it increases as time went on, by bed time my chest and lower throat hurt so bad, I couldn't stand it, it seems like movement make it hurt worse, took zantac thinking gastric reflux, although I've never had that, and a pain reliever neither one helped.

As per your query you have symptoms of throat pain which seems to be due to upper respiratory tract infection or poor immunity of body and due to excessive acid production in body. Need not to worry. Avoid intake of cold carbonated beverages. Avoid intake of sharp spicy food. You should apply mist humidifiers in room. You should take throat lozenges to soothe throat. Visit ENT specialist once and get it examined and start treatment after proper prescription. You should maintain oral hygiene. Do warm saline gargles. You can go for blood and sputum tests as well. You should take proper course of antibiotics along with antiinflammatory medications.
